Install nextcloud-nginx on Fedora 36 Using dnf

Update yum database with dnf using the following command.

sudo dnf makecache --refresh

After updating yum database, We can install nextcloud-nginx using dnf by running the following command:

sudo dnf -y install nextcloud-nginx

How To Uninstall nextcloud-nginx on Fedora 36

To uninstall only the nextcloud-nginx package we can use the following command:

sudo dnf remove nextcloud-nginx

nextcloud-nginx Package Contents on Fedora 36

/etc/nginx/conf.d/nextcloud.conf
/etc/nginx/default.d/nextcloud.conf
/etc/php-fpm.d/nextcloud.conf
